2N7002 - N-Channel Enhancement Mode MOSFET

Overview

The 2N7002 is a widely used N-channel enhancement mode MOSFET designed for low-voltage, low-current applications. It is a small-signal transistor that provides efficient switching and amplification capabilities. The device is characterized by its fast switching speeds, low on-resistance, and compatibility with logic-level signals, making it ideal for interfacing with CMOS and TTL circuits.

This MOSFET is commonly employed in applications requiring high efficiency and minimal power dissipation. Its compact size and robust performance make it suitable for a variety of electronic designs, from consumer electronics to industrial control systems.
